.tvo_kuvakaruselli{
	position: relative;
	margin: 0px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 1.1em;
}

.tvo_kuvakaruselli .karuselli_wrapper{
	position: relative;
	width: 1030px;
	height: 303px;
	overflow: hidden;
}
.tvo_kuvakaruselli .karuselli_wrapper .karusellikuvat{
	position: absolute;
	left: 0px;
	top: 0px;
	width: 1030px;
	height: 303px;
	overflow: hidden;
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va{
	position: relative;
	width: 1030px;
	height: 303px;
	float: left;
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va img{
	position: absolute;
	top: 0px;
	left: 62px;	
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va h2{
	position: absolute;
	margin: 0px;
	top: 66px;
	right: 55px;
	width: 380px;
	font-family: 'ExoLight','Exo', Arial, Helvetica, sans-serif;
	font-weight: 200;
	font-size: 38px;
	line-height: 38px;
}
.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va h2 {
	color: #434343;	
}
.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va h2 .sininen{
	color: #1069a7;	
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va .rivit2{
	top: 90px;
	font-size: 52px;
	line-height: 52px;
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va .rivit3{
	top: 85px;
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va .rivit4{
	top: 66px;
}

.tvo_kuvakaruselli .karuselli_wrapper .karusellikuva .kapea{
	width: 320px;	
}


.tvo_kuvakaruselli .karuselli_wrapper .puolipallo{
	position: absolute;
	top: 0px;
	left: 300px;
	height: 303px;
	z-index: 10;
}/**/
.tvo_kuvakaruselli .karuselli_wrapper .puolipallo img{
	position: absolute;
	bottom: 0px;
	left: 0px;
}

.tvo_kuvakaruselli .karuselli_wrapper .pallot{
	z-index: 11;
	position: absolute;
	bottom: 19px;
	right: 0px;
	visibility: hidden;	
}

.tvo_kuvakaruselli .karuselli_wrapper .pallot img{
	margin-left: 6px;
	cursor: pointer;
	
}

.tvo_kuvakaruselli .karuselli_wrapper .edellinen, .tvo_kuvakaruselli .karuselli_wrapper  .seuraava{
	position: absolute;
	top: 0px;
	text-align: center;
	cursor: pointer;
	z-index: 10;
	height: 303px;
}

.tvo_kuvakaruselli .karuselli_wrapper .edellinen img, .tvo_kuvakaruselli .karuselli_wrapper  .seuraava img{
	margin-top: 135px;	
}

.tvo_kuvakaruselli .karuselli_wrapper .edellinen{
	left: 0px;
}
.tvo_kuvakaruselli .karuselli_wrapper .seuraava{
	right: 0px;
}